Job Description

AriensCo is currently hiring a Production Trainer in our Paint department on 1st shift at our Brillion, WI location! In this role, you will play a key part in training and supporting team members within the department.

Pay: Starting at $24.00/hour + $4,000 sign on bonus

Schedule & Shift: Monday - Thursday (4 days x 10 hours); 4:45 AM-2:45 PM

Day to Day Responsibilities
  • Adhere to company Core Values and Principles and review with new employees
  • Review company administration policies and procedures with new employees
  • Review department specific procedures/expectations with new employees
  • Ensure a safe working environment at all times
  • Train new and existing employees using TWI (Training Within Industry) Job Instruction
  • Evaluate trainee performance and enter data electronically
  • Monitor metrics and assist Trainer II in determining training opportunities while working with Team Leaders to coordinate training schedule
  • Manage tooling maintenance including all training materials and Training Cell 6S efforts
  • Report individual training evaluation results to Manufacturing Leader to determine action
  • Assist team members in other areas to meet daily production goals
  • Work as part of a team having responsibility for producing outdoor power equipment
  • Strict adherence to standard work
  • Perform Assembly II production functions, using any equipment necessary to complete stations
  • In a team setting, troubleshoot Safety, Quality and Productivity issues
  • Participate on at least one Kaizen Event or complete a combination of 12 Kaizen Implements or Problem Solvings per year
Qualifications
  • Minimum of a High School diploma or general education degree (GED) required
  • Ability to communicate effectively
  • Capable of performing multiple assembly stations/processes adhering to standard work
  • Strong Microsoft Office preferred
  • Applicants must be authorized to work in the U.S. without requiring sponsorship now or in the future.
